    It's no secret that Greg and I are good friends even though we are "competitors" but I have the go ahead to let the cat out of the bag.

    In about 4 weeks Beech Grove Firearms will be starting construction of a new store at 3020 South Emerson (in the old flooring store) in Beech Grove.

    The store will be roughly 17,000sq feet and will include the following: 4x more retail room, a 25-30 bay indoor shooting range (up to .30 caliber rifle), a 70 car parking lot (no more looking for a spot on main street!), plus much more behind the scene stuff that will improve customer service.

    From what I can gather, this will be the largest public indoor shooting range in Indiana!!!! The options for leagues and training ect. are endless!!!
